Runbook: LockerLoop access flow (contractor onboarding)

When a resident reports a stuck laundry locker, first query the DoorState service to confirm the latch status. If the latch reads "pending," issue a remote release via the access endpoint; never force a manual override without a logged ticket. All calls to DoorState require the staging credential issued for contractors. That credential is shown directly below this paragraph.

gateway credential: kto23_LX9A4ys6i4nzHtpOLNLodKK

## Further Reading

So the Quillbase planner regression: after the 4.2 upgrade, certain join-heavy queries started picking nested loops over hash joins and latency went sideways. If you're paged for slow reads, check the plan cache first before blaming the replicas. The full write-up, repro queries, and the mitigation toggle are documented on the internal page.

dashboard of kawip-kajep = https://jira.qorvellabs.internal/display/browse/projects/projects/a194

Facilities ticket — Lost badge, new starter orientation, Wexhall Annexe. Procedure for new starters: report the loss to the facilities desk immediately so the old badge can be deactivated. A replacement takes up to two working days. Meanwhile, do not tailgate through secured doors; sign in at the desk each morning instead. For the interim period you may use the temporary door code provided below.

door code, yagap-bahof: bdg-O-05